The Jonatha D Licht Lab is a renowned research facility dedicated to advancing our understanding of the molecular mechanisms underlying various diseases. Located at the University of Florida, the lab is led by Dr. Jonatha D Licht, a distinguished expert in the field of molecular biology and genetics. With a strong focus on interdisciplinary research, the lab collaborates with clinicians, scientists, and engineers to develop innovative solutions for complex medical problems.

Research Focus and Expertise

The Jonatha D Licht Lab specializes in investigating the molecular basis of cancer, with a particular emphasis on leukemia and lymphoma. The lab’s research team employs a range of cutting-edge techniques, including chromatin immunoprecipitation sequencing (ChIP-seq), RNA sequencing (RNA-seq), and CRISPR-Cas9 genome editing, to study the role of transcriptional regulators in cancer development and progression. By elucidating the underlying molecular mechanisms, the lab aims to identify novel therapeutic targets and develop more effective treatments for these devastating diseases.
